Court case: Terraza v. Safeway Inc. 401(k) Settlement
Safeway Inc. and its 401(k) plan administrator, Aon, settled an ERISA lawsuit alleging the retirement plan was mismanaged and charged excessive fees to participants. The settlement fund included $500,000 contributed by Aon, along with amounts from the Safeway defendants, reduced by court-approved attorneys' fees and administrative costs. The claim filing window closed on February 26, 2021.
Official eligibility wordingParticipants in the Safeway Inc. 401(k) Plan at any time from July 14, 2010 to July 28, 2016, or beneficiaries/alternate payees of such participants. Checked against the official settlement source by SettleSignal on June 18, 2026.

- Current participants with active Plan accounts receive payment automatically — filing a claim form when you are not required to could cause confusion
- Former participants must affirmatively file; failing to submit a Claim Form means forfeiting your share of the settlement fund
- The distribution has already been sent, meaning the claims period is closed — check with the administrator if you believe you missed the deadline

Plaintiffs: Maria Karla Terraza and Dennis M. Lorenz Defendants: Safeway Inc., the Safeway Benefit Plans Committee, committee members, and Aon Hewitt Investment Consulting Inc.
